    Trills involve the vibration of one of the speech organs. Since trilling is a separate parameter from stricture, the two may be combined. Increasing the stricture of a typical trill results in a trilled fricative. Trilled affricates are also known. Nasal airflow may be added as an independent parameter to any speech sound.

    From most open (least stricture) to most close (most stricture), there are several independent relationships among speech sounds. Open vowel → mid vowel → close vowel → approximant → fricative → plosive is one; flap → stop is another; and trill → trilled fricative yet another.

    Sound sources refer to the conversion of aerodynamic energy into acoustic energy. There are two main types of sound sources in the articulatory system: periodic (or more precisely semi-periodic) and aperiodic. A periodic sound source is vocal fold vibration produced at the glottis found in vowels and voiced consonants.

    In articulatory phonetics, a consonant is a speech sound that is articulated with complete or partial closure of the vocal tract, except for the h sound, which is pronounced without any stricture in the vocal tract.

    The voiceless glottal fricative, sometimes called voiceless glottal transition or the aspirate, [1] [2] is a type of sound used in some spoken languages that patterns like a fricative or approximant consonant phonologically, but often lacks the usual phonetic characteristics of a consonant.
